Nichtgelesene Registerkarte aktualisiert sich nach dem Lesen nicht

Tritt das Einfrieren nur auf deinem Mobiltelefon auf?

Dies passiert auch ohne Whisper-Nachrichten. Es tritt sowohl auf dem Desktop (Chrome) als auch auf dem mobilen Safari auf. Gerne kann ich einige Bildschirmaufnahmen zur Verfügung stellen, falls Sie möchten.

1 „Gefällt mir“

Ein Hard Refresh scheint das Problem nicht zu lösen.

1 „Gefällt mir“

Ja, ich sehe dieses Problem nur auf meinem Handy. Genauer gesagt: Wenn ich ein Thema auf meinem Handy besucht habe und es nicht als gelesen markiert wurde, wird es auch auf dem Desktop weiterhin als ungelesen angezeigt. Ich habe jedoch noch nicht erlebt, dass ein Beitrag nach dem Besuch auf dem Desktop nicht als gelesen markiert wurde.

Das ist ein weiterer Beleg dafür, dass es sich um ein “Schreib”-Problem und nicht um ein “Lesen”-Problem handelt.

2 „Gefällt mir“

Das klingt für mich nach einem Problem im Zusammenhang mit einem Service Worker. Ich vermute stark, dass dein Android-Gerät fälschlicherweise annimmt, es sei offline, obwohl tatsächlich eine Netzwerkverbindung besteht. Verschwindet der blaue Lese-Punkt bei dir?

Ich denke, wir müssen eine klare und auffällige Anzeige auf dem Bildschirm hinzufügen, wenn der Service Worker annimmt, du seist offline.

2 „Gefällt mir“

Das denke ich auch.

Hmmm… Meinst du den blauen Punkt bei jedem Beitrag? Ich sehe das auf dem Handy nicht, egal ob die Funktion arbeitet oder nicht.

2 „Gefällt mir“

Vielleicht ist der blaue Punkt unter Android komplett zurückgegangen, @sam? Kannst du das überprüfen, @falco?

Nein, ich denke, wir unterdrücken es auf Mobilgeräten der Einfachheit halber. Wir können hier eine Theme-Komponente hinzufügen, die es wiederherstellt.

2 „Gefällt mir“

Hey Leute, hier ist der OP. Keiner unserer Nutzer verwendet Android. Das passiert universell auf allen Geräten, auf denen ich es getestet habe. Unser Feed mit ungelesenen Nachrichten wird nicht aktualisiert.

2 „Gefällt mir“

Können Sie das Problem auf dieser Seite nachstellen?

Nein, ich habe das Problem auf Meta nicht gesehen. Nur auf unserer eigenen Website, die bei Ihnen gehostet wird.

2 „Gefällt mir“

Das gleiche Verhalten hier. Ich weiß, dass ich diesen Beitrag gelesen habe, da ich einen Kommentar im ersten ungelesenen Thema liked habe. Auf Meta bestätigt. Wird dennoch auf dem Android-Mobilgerät als ungelesen markiert. Irgendwann wird es funktionieren, aber es dauert etwas. Ich musste den Thread mehrfach öffnen.

Wir erhalten Benutzerberichte über Probleme, die den in diesem Thread gemeldeten sehr ähnlich klingen. Wir konnten die Ursache noch nicht eingrenzen, aber bei uns stammen die Berichte zu 100 % von Android-Nutzern (ich selbst bin ein iOS-Entwickler). Mehr als fünf verschiedene Personen haben dies gemeldet, sodass ich zunehmend den Verdacht habe, dass etwas nicht stimmt. Ich kann Ihnen jedoch derzeit nicht weiterhelfen.

Wir werden das Problem weiterhin verfolgen.

3 „Gefällt mir“

Ich kann dies unter Chrome Android schließlich reproduzieren und werde nächste Woche nachforschen.

Meine Vermutung ist, dass etwas eine kürzlich von @david in diesem Codepfad eingeführte Korrektur beschädigt hat.

3 „Gefällt mir“

Hinweis an @falco: Bei tappara.co setzen wir auf Stabilität.

1 „Gefällt mir“

Das ist interessant, denn in der stabilen Version fehlen die neuen Service-Worker-Teile (Offline-Unterstützung mit WorkboxJS), sodass ich sie damit quasi nicht kaputt machen kann :zany_face:

4 „Gefällt mir“

Ich glaube, hier stecken sozusagen 3 verschiedene Fehlerberichte in einem.

4 „Gefällt mir“

@ljpp hat nicht erwähnt, dass ich dieses Problem zum ersten Mal vor Monaten auf Tappara.co hatte. Ich habe im Mai in unserer Mitarbeiterkategorie darüber gepostet. Damals nutzten wir die stabile Version 2.2. Seitdem tritt es bei mir selten auf. Es erscheint mir seltsam, dass andere Nutzer dieses Problem erst in den letzten paar Wochen erleben.

Ja, ich habe es weggelassen, da sich dieses Problem in den letzten Wochen eindeutig verschärft hat, während wir unsere Discourse-Codebasis seit einiger Zeit nicht aktualisiert haben. Das könnte darauf hindeuten, dass das Problem auf der Chrome-Seite liegt.

Wie @sam bereits vorgeschlagen hat, ist es zudem möglich, dass es tatsächlich mehrere Probleme mit ähnlichen Symptomen gibt. Wir müssen es irgendwie eingrenzen.